Land Bank chief financial officer quits

The Land Bank on Tuesday confirmed that its chief financial officer Wolf Meyer has resigned, a spokesman said.

"[He] has accepted a more competitive offer at another institution. He leaves the bank on 10 June 2011," Musa Mchunu said in a statement.

CEO Phakamani Hadebe thanked Meyer for his contribution to the company.

"I would like to express the Land Bank's gratitude to Wolf Meyer for the role he has played in stabilising the bank's finances and contributing to the unqualified audits the bank has received in the past two years.

"Wolf leaves a strengthened team in finance, and the bank is taking appropriate steps to ensure rapid succession and appropriate capacity in the business unit."
